发表于: 2017-11-11 22:30:54
1 685
今天完成的任务
进行了方案评审,存在的问题如下:
这里是因为我们对实名列表的理解出现了偏差。我们认为实名列表是所有已经提交实名申请的用户的当前认证状态,每重新提交一次实名申请就会覆盖原来的记录。经过师兄解答后,发现这个实名列表实际是用户的实名申请历史记录,用户的每一次申请都记录下来。因为同一个用户在实名列表里可能多个认证申请记录,为了表示用户当前实名状态,要在user表添加一个表示用户当前认证状态的字段。
这里是关于解绑银行卡的。我们原先的方案是,解绑银行卡后,直接删除数据库的记录。但是按照“保留所有记录”的原则,不能直接删除数据库记录,而是添加一个“是否失效”的字段。
这个做方案设计的时候就已经知道了。正常来说是不会提供取消实名功能的,所以只要把取消实名的接口取消掉就可以了。
把表从navicat移到Excel的时候,搭档把这个交易类型和交易结果合成一个交易结果的字段了。经过师兄的解答,还是要把类型和结果给分开成两个字段。
关联表的设计原来是考虑可以准确的记录每一条消息是否已读、是否被用户逻辑删除,缺点是每新增一条公告消息就要在关联表内插入等同于所有用户量的数据。师兄们给的意见是取消关联表,在user表新增一个“未读消息条数”的字段,有新消息,该字段值+1,读新消息后,该字段值-1。
但是师兄们的方案,我还没想出来用户把消息删掉之后,消息中心该怎么进行展示?
这个问题可以总结为续投生效的条件是什么。原来我对续投列表的展示规则的理解有3条,1是限购产品不可续投,2是已经下架的产品不可续投,3是即将到期(5天)的产品才能续投。当用户点击续投后,直接在投资表插入一条新的投资记录,起息日期为父投资的到期日期。
这一块的问题有两个,我还没想好怎么解决:
1、如果续投成功后,该续投产品被下架,续投是否生效?
2、如果续投成功后,产品下架一段时间,然后又上架,续投是否生效?
7、解绑默认卡后,新的默认卡要怎么设置,回款的卡号怎么修改
当用户把默认卡挂失后,只是关闭了默认卡的支出功能,但还是可以往默认卡打钱。而且,在挂失期间往默认卡打钱会自动转入到新卡。
我们在后台解绑银行卡后,由用户自行绑定新的银行卡并设置新的默认卡。自动回款的逻辑是,查找用户的“默认卡”,而不是把回款的账号写死。但这种逻辑也有漏洞,这样就没有限制同卡进出了...
还需要再想想
见上面第5条最后的问题
纠正了对原型理解不对的地方(实名列表),以及应该提前考虑好的以外情况的处理办法
3、搭档去问老大,我们现在使用的拆分投资、拆分债权后再进行匹配的方案是否合理。
评论